THE performance of two singers during Anugerah Juara Lagu 36 on Sunday has caught the attention of critics and fans, reported Malay dailies.
Many questioned Siti Nordiana’s lacklustre rendition of the song Angkara, while others said Aina Abdul’s “flower tree” outfit was tasteless.
Harian Metro reported that one of those who expressed surprise with the performance of Siti Nordiana – popularly known as Nana – was singer Azmeer Arif.
“Awat (why) Nana sings like she lacks energy? She’s not singing like usual, is she sick?” he wrote on Facebook.
Meanwhile, people criticised Aina for appearing in a gown decked with green branches and purple and red blooms during her duet with Khai Bahar for the song Nafas Cinta. “Did Aina Abdul just walk through some bushes before going up to ‘perform’ on stage? A lot of grass (and) trees seem to be stuck (on her dress),” said a netizen on Twitter, according to Kosmo!.This was not the first time that the singer, whose real name is Nurul Aina Abdul Ghani, got more attention for her outfit than her talent.
Her ‘blood’-dripping outfit while she performed her song Sumpah during Anugerah Juara Lagu in 2019 created controversy among fans and audience, who accused her of promoting suicide.
However, she denied this, adding that it was to highlight the theme of a “broken heart” in the song.
> Utusan Malaysia reported that a video of Penang sepak takraw player, Muhamad Zulhusni Basri, 21, having his front tooth stuck in the net during a match has gone viral over social media.
The player – better known as Mat Oni – was playing in the second set of a match against rival team Bomba Fighters, when his front tooth got caught in the net.
“Because of the incident, one of my teeth is loose.
“Maybe it was pulled when it was stuck,” said the Black Panthers player, who considered the video a source of encouragement for him to continue excelling in the sport.
The 55-second video, which was also shared through the SepakTakraw League’s Facebook page, has got over 236,000 views and 1,800 shares since it was uploaded on Saturday.
Some 8,300 emojis of laughter were also left on the post, with many describing it as the funniest closing for a match.
In that match, the Black Panthers won 2-0 in the Division One championship.
